 Disney After Hours Returns to Walt Disney World Resort in 2025

Walt Disney World Resort is set to rekindle the magic of its famed Disney After Hours events in 2025, offering guests and their families late-night adventures in some of the park's most iconic locations. These exclusive, separately ticketed events ensure a more intimate experience by limiting attendance, allowing visitors to savor the delights of Magic Kingdom Park, Disney’s Hollywood Studios, and EPCOT long after the sun has set. 

  

An Enchanted Evening Awaits: Guests can begin their mystical nights as early as 7 p.m., roaming the parks for three extra hours post-official closing. With significantly shorter wait times for beloved attractions, iconic character meet-and-greets, and a selection of delicious snacks such as ice cream, popcorn, and select beverages included, these events promise a magical, memorable evening for all. Kicking off on January 6 at Magic Kingdom, January 22 at Disney’s Hollywood Studios, and February 27 at EPCOT, Disney After Hours is poised to offer an unforgettable nocturnal escape. 

  

Exclusive Access and Event Times:  

Magic Kingdom and EPCOT Events: 10 p.m. - 1 a.m. 

Hollywood Studios Events: 9:30 p.m. - 12:30 a.m.

Ticket Information 

Priced between $175 to $185 (plus tax) for Magic Kingdom, $155 to $175 (plus tax) for EPCOT, and $155 to $185 (plus tax) for Disney’s Hollywood Studios, tickets for these coveted events go on sale September 4 for guests staying at select Walt Disney World Resort hotels, Walt Disney World Swan and Dolphin Hotels, and Shades of Green. General ticket sales begin September 10. 

  

Holidays at Disneyland

The holidays at Disneyland Resort capture the magic of gathering with loved ones, following cherished traditions, and giving thanks. From November 15, 2024, through January 6, 2025, visitors can immerse themselves in festive experiences and celebrate the debut of Tiana’s Bayou Adventure at Disneyland Park. 


New Holiday Experiences for 2024: 

- Santa Claus and beloved characters will create special memories at the Fantasyland Theatre, featuring cookie decorating, crafts, storytelling, and festive music. 

- Photo ops with Santa at various locations, including Disneyland Park, Disney California Adventure Park, and Disneyland Resort Hotels. 

- Mickey and Minnie will debut charming new outfits, evoking the spirit of holiday letter-writing. 

- New activities like Chip and Dale’s Ornament Trail at Downtown Disney District from November 22, 2024, to January 1, 2025. 

- New holiday-themed dishes, including fan favorites like Mickey Gingerbread, and Goofy’s Kitchen Celebrates the Holidays! at Disneyland Hotel starting November 19. 

Beloved Holiday Decor and Entertainment: 

- Sparkling holiday decor perfect for family photos. 

- Holiday Time at the Disneyland Resort Guided Tour with treats and reserved parade viewing. 

- Festive fun at all three Disneyland Resort Hotels, including a massive gingerbread house display at Disney’s Grand Californian Hotel & Spa. 

- Traditional nighttime spectaculars like "Believe...In Holiday Magic" and "World of Color – Season of Light," featuring fireworks and “snowfall”. 

- Seasonal overlays on attractions like “it’s a small world” Holiday and Haunted Mansion Holiday. 

- The Disney ¡Viva Navidad! street party and Disney Festival of Holidays at Disney California Adventure, showcasing diverse cultural celebrations with flavorful food, live entertainment, and scannable Sip and Savor Passes. 

Celebrate the Opening of Tiana’s Bayou Adventure: 

- Opening November 15, 2024, join Princess Tiana and alligator Louis on an enchanting journey through the bayou, with original and beloved songs from "The Princess and the Frog”. 

- Discover themed merchandise at Ray’s Berets and Louis’ Critter Club in Disneyland Park.

Downtown Disney District at Disneyland Resort Expands

We're excited to share that Downtown Disney District is getting some fantastic new additions! 

  

1. Avengers Reserve Shop: Opening this winter, a new shop dedicated to Earth’s Mightiest Heroes, featuring collectibles, apparel, accessories, toys, and comics. 

  

2. D-Lander Shop: Another winter debut, this boutique will offer trendy, Southern California-style fashions for Disneyland fans. 

  

3. Disney Wonderful World of Sweets: Marceline’s Confectionery will transform into whimsical sweets shop this winter, featuring favorites like churro toffee, caramel apples, and more, made in an exhibition kitchen. 

  

4. Kawaii Slime Cart: Launching this fall, kids and adults can enjoy the cutest slime ever at this cart full of imaginative slime concoctions. 

  

5. Michelin-Starred Chef Joe Isidori's Restaurants: Two new eateries are in the works - a full-service steakhouse with prime cuts and sophisticated ambiance, and a BBQ spot with traditional dishes and craft beers, set where Tortilla Jo’s used to be. 

  

6. The Carnaby Tavern by Earl of Sandwich: Coming soon, this new concept will feature a British Invasion-themed full-service restaurant with indoor/outdoor bar. Existing Earl of Sandwich locations will remain open till 2025.
